base_convert Convert a number between arbitrary bases &reftitle.description; stringbase_convert stringnum intfrom_base intto_base Returns a string containing num represented in base to_base. The base in which num is given is specified in from_base. Both from_base and to_base have to be between 2 and 36, inclusive. Digits in numbers with a base higher than 10 will be represented with the letters a-z, with a meaning 10, b meaning 11 and z meaning 35. The case of the letters doesn't matter, i.e. num is interpreted case-insensitively. base_convert may lose precision on large numbers due to properties related to the internal float type used. Please see the Floating point numbers section in the manual for more specific information and limitations. &reftitle.parameters; num The number to convert. Any invalid characters in num are silently ignored.
